Abstract

This paper describes physical measures for quantifying the quality of light sources and their characteristics. Typical light sources, including incandescent lamps, fluorescent lamps and light emitting diodes, are first introduced and their performance is compared. The CIE colour specification system is then described, including physical quantities for specifying light sources such as colour temperature, spectral power distribution, luminance, illuminance, luminous efficacy, chromaticity coordinates, uniform colour spaces, a colour difference formula and a colour appearance model. Finally, the CIE colour rendering index, together with recent developments towards a new index, including CRI‐CAM02UCS, is described.
